The Belvil pairs a recycled elm timber frame with a woven rattan seat for a relaxed Hamptons armchair full of natural character.

Finished in a rubbed-down black, each piece carries the warmth and individuality of reclaimed timber.

Key Features

  • Recycled elm timber frame with a woven rattan seat
  • Rubbed-down black finish with characterful Hamptons styling
  • Sustainable use of reclaimed timber
  • Each piece unique in grain and character
  • Requires only minimal assembly

Specifications

  • Dimensions: 57cm W × 60cm D × 85cm H
  • Seat Height: 45cm
  • Arm Height: 67cm
  • Timber: Recycled Elm
  • Seat: Rattan
  • Colour: Rubbed Down Black
  • Assembly: Minimal Assembly Required
  • Warranty: 12-month manufacturer's warranty

Care: dust regularly with a soft brush or cloth and wipe with a barely-damp cloth, drying promptly. Keep out of prolonged direct sunlight to protect the timber and weave.
